How do you secure an elevated deer blind?

On each leg, place the iron tight against the leg with the hole at the top. Drive the angle into the soil until the hole is about 6″ above the soil surface. With a 1/4″ bit drill through the hole in the angle and completely through the leg, and secure them together with a galvanized bolt and nut.

How do you anchor down a tower blind?

Run a piece of wire rope from two corners of the blind down to a turn buckle at the auger. I turn the augers down 3 ft and use the turn buckle to adjust the tension. One auger on each side of the blind holds everything just fine.

How high should a deer blind be off the ground?

What is the best height for a blind? Every hunter has different needs, so it is always best to pick hunting equipment or tactics that work best for your specific style of hunting, but a good rule of thumb is about 5-10 feet off the ground.

How do you anchor into dirt?

Using a sledge hammer (or club hammer for small anchors), force the anchor into the ground, it will rotate when hit and cut a precise thread in the ground. Continue until close to or at ground level.

How do you anchor a tower stand?

Place your stand over the center of the mesquite trunk. Attach your cables crisscross threw the eyebolt to the 4 corners of the tower. Use the turn buckle to cinch the tower down. That should do it!

Is a ground blind better than a tree stand?

Treestands offer a distinct advantage over ground blinds for most archery purposes because bowhunting requires more movement to get into position and draw a recurve or compound bow for the shot. The margin for error is much smaller.

How high should a deer stand be on the wall?

You only need a shooting house to be high enough to provide a good view of your hunting area. The higher you build it, the more it will cost and the harder it will be to construct. For most areas, a platform 4 to 6 feet above the ground will get the hunter high enough to provide a good view of the surrounding area.

How are metal carports anchored to the ground?

Rebar anchors are used to reinforce metal carports to gravel or bare soil foundations. Rebar anchors are effective on areas that are not windy. High winds erode the area around the anchor and this affects the stability of the entire structure.

How are carports secured to the ground?

Mobile home anchors, or auger anchors, are used to keep structures secure to dirt or soil. When installing a custom-built carport, a poured foundation is not necessary, but you do need a level site for a firm hold. The auger style helps the anchor stay secure to the ground and prevents the custom carport from moving.
